#10 BJP MPs Including 2 Ministers Resign From Lok Sabha After Assembly Poll Win

Ten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) Lok Sabha MPs including two Union ministers who won the assembly elections in three states of Rajasthan, Chhattisgarh and Madhya Pradesh, resigned from the Lok Sabha on Wednesday, people familiar with the matter said.

The 10 members of Parliament submitted their resignation to the Lok Sabha speaker’s office after calling on Prime Minister Narendra Modi and BJP president JP Nadda. The party president accompanied them to the speaker’s office.

BJP MLAs walk out of Assembly over CM Siddaramaiah’s announcement on minority welfare funds

Karnataka BJP MLAs staged a walkout on Wednesday protesting against an announcement made by Chief Minister Siddaramaiah outside the legislature about increasing the minority welfare funds from Rs 4,000 crore to Rs 10,000 crore in the coming years.

BJP MLAs alleged that Siddaramaiah had broken the tradition by making an announcement outside the Legislature when it was in session. The chief minister said at a convention in Hubballi on Monday that he would increase the allocation to the minority welfare department every year, adding that the government was looking to spend Rs 10,000 crore in the coming years.

Telangana's CM-elect Revanth Reddy meets Cong president Mallikarjun Kharge

Telangana's chief minister-elect Revanth Reddy met Congress president Mallikarjun Kharge here on Wednesday, a day after he was elected leader of the Congress Legislature Party.

He later met Congress Parliamentary Party chairperson Sonia Gandhi and former party chief Rahul Gandhi.

Reddy, who has been elected from the Kodangal Assembly seat, is slated to take oath as chief minister in Hyderabad on Thursday.

PM Modi hails Garba as 'celebration of life' after UNESCO's listing of dance form as 'Intangible Heritage'

Garba, the traditional dance form of western India's Gujarat which is also the home state of India's Prime Minister Narendra Modi, has been declared as an Intangible Heritage by the United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organisation (UNESCO). 

 

In a post on social media platform X (formerly Twitter) on Wednesday, UNESCO posted, "New inscription on the Intangible Heritage List: Garba of Gujarat, India. Congratulations!"

Prime Minister Narendra Modi also reacted to the development and hailed Garba as "a celebration of life".
